When I moved from Florida to Alabama during the middle of the winter last year, I had to do make-shift indoor pens for my tortoises and box turtles. For the box turtles, I used a children's pool, not the smallest one, but the next size up. Cost maybe $12 at Wal-Mart. For bedding, I used topsoil with a layer of mulch on top. I wasn't trying to breed them, but looking back, it seems to me that the pool could be ideal for breeding, depending on the size of the group. ----- Hold my breath as I wish for death.
